About Mark

Mark Bryant practices personal injury law at Bryant Law Center, with offices strategically located in Paducah, Louisville, and Mayfield, Kentucky. Founded in 1990, the firm quickly established a reputation for handling a diverse range of cases, emphasizing a approach. His primary focus is on personal injury law, but he also represents clients in medical malpractice, criminal law, consumer law, nursing home abuse, products liability, and maritime law. This wide-ranging expertise allows him to address various legal challenges faced by individuals and families in Kentucky. Mark earned his Juris Doctor (J.D.) degree from the University of Kentucky College of Law in 1989.
